What is a merchant cash advance?

A merchant cash advance (MCA) is a way to obtain business funding by selling a portion of your future credit card sales for an upfront sum. It's a faster alternative to traditional loans, ideal for California businesses needing quick capital. We offer MCAs to support you.

What is MCA in loans?

MCA stands for Merchant Cash Advance. It's a financing method providing upfront capital based on future sales, rather than a traditional loan with fixed payments. This is a common and effective solution for many California businesses needing swift funding.
